Nice Looks but Poor Quality Parts

Michael December 13, 2022

Table looks good but the balls are cheap and not properly balanced so they shift direction at the end of a roll (not the table). The cue sticks are really cheap as is the brush. They should keep the low quality accessories and just reduce the price a bit instead. Although I'm sure they aren't worth much. Also, they include a wrench for the assembly bolts but it didn't fit the heads of the bolts so it was useless. The bolt heads have a non-standard size making it difficult to find a wrench to fit. No sockets either metric or standard fit. The only thing that worked was an open end 12mm wrench but even it wasn't a 100% fit. Also, some of the wood screws for the legs wouldn't tighten completely as the holes drilled might have been a bit too big. I had to insert toothpick pieces so they tightened properly.

Don't Spend the money; not worth it!

Shawn December 11, 2022

As far as quality goes, this is a $300 pool table with a $1200 price tag; not worth the money. First day we started playing on it the felt started shedding severely; it was coming off in small clumps. Also, the rails/bumpers have almost no give/play, so the balls stops on the rails a lot. The table top is also cheaply made, so don't let the picture fool you, it is not what you would expect for $1200. The underneath and the legs of the table are built with some quality and that quality should have carried over to the playing surface (Table top) itself. My brother in law bought a pool table on Amazon that is leaps and bounds ahead in quality of the Fat Cat Reno, and with a price point of $485. Wish I would have gotten that one. However, if you still insist on purchasing this, I recommend not purchasing the Angi Home Service assembly package at time of order. I would work through Angi separately. It is cheaper, less confusing and more organized.
